Adding a new editor requires User-scope editors (e.g., opencode) write to a path resolved in `paths.ts` rather than the project tree — `configureEditorSettings` returns that path for the init summary and the real work happens in `tryInstallPlugin`. **Match the target editor's actual path resolution — don't assume Windows conventions.** opencode uses the `xdg-basedir` npm package, which falls back to `~/.config` on **all platforms** (including Windows, where it resolves to `C:\Users\\.config\…`, not `%APPDATA%\…`). `opencodeAgentsDir()` must mirror that exact logic or the CLI writes files the editor can't find. When adding a user-scope editor, verify the editor's path helper in its source before writing the resolver. + +**opencode ships two distributions — CLI detection alone misses the Desktop app.** The `opencode` CLI is one distribution; the opencode Desktop app (Electron-based, e.g. `@opencode-aidesktop` on Windows) is another, and it ships **no CLI binary at all** — `isOpencodeCliAvailable()` (a PATH check via `resolveCommand`) can never detect it. Both distributions read/write the same `opencodeConfigDir()` (`~/.config/opencode/`), so `isOpencodeAvailable()` in `plugin-install.ts` also treats that directory's existence as a valid installed-opencode signal.
